软件开发程序猿学什么(学做软件开发)

小编

是哪种职业的俗称

“打金”是金银匠的俗称。在传统语境中,“打金”这一称谓具有鲜明的行业特征与技术内涵。“打”字特指手工敲打、锻造这一金属加工方式,是金属冷加工的核心技术体现。老一辈人提及“打金”,往往会联想到匠人使用火炉、铁砧、小锤等工具,对金片、银条进行反复捶打、延展、塑形的场景。

“打金”是金银匠的俗称,其工作围绕金、银等贵金属展开,与铸铁匠在原料、工艺等方面存在差异。职业核心特征1)金银匠以金、银等贵金属为主要原料,借助熔铸、锤打等传统工艺制作首饰等物品;铸铁匠以铁为原料,专注于铁器铸造等。

码农是程序员或软件开发工程师的俗称,常见于互联网行业。 这个称呼通常用来形容长时间与代码打交道、工作节奏快且需要较强技术能力的从业者。名称里的“农”带有一定调侃意味,既突出高强度工作状态,又暗含行业对技术迭代速度的要求。

“打金”是金银匠的俗称。这一职业主要以金、银等贵金属为原料,通过锻造、錾刻、焊接等工艺制作首饰、器具等物品,其核心工艺与“金”“银”材料紧密相关;而铸铁匠的工作对象是铁,与“打金”的原料和工艺范畴不同。

敲代码的程序猿属于什么专业

1、敲代码的程序猿主要属于电子信息专业、通信专业、软件工程等专业。以下是对这些专业及其与程序员角色的详细解析: 电子信息专业:专业特点:电子信息专业主要研究信息的获取、传输、处理以及利用等方面的基本知识和技能。

2、敲代码的程序猿主要属于电子信息专业、通信专业、软件工程等专业。具体来说:电子信息专业:该专业涉及电子信息技术的基础理论和应用,包括电子技术、信息处理、通信技术等,为成为程序员提供了必要的技术基础。通信专业:通信专业主要研究信息的传输、交换和处理,涉及通信原理、通信网络技术等内容。

3、敲代码的程序猿主要属于电子信息专业、通信专业、软件工程等专业。具体来说:电子信息专业:该专业涉及电子技术和信息系统的研究、设计、开发和应用,为成为程序员提供了必要的技术基础。

4、敲代码的程序猿主要属于电子信息专业、通信专业、软件工程等专业。以下是关于程序员所属专业的详细解主要相关专业 电子信息专业:该专业涉及电子信息技术的基础理论和应用,包括电路与系统、信号与信息处理、通信技术等方向,为成为程序员提供了坚实的电子技术基础。

5、敲代码的程序猿属于多个不同的专业,主要包括电子信息专业、通信专业、软件工程等。电子信息专业:该专业主要学习电子技术、信息处理技术和计算机技术等知识,为从事程序开发和维护工作打下坚实基础。

软件开发程序猿学什么(学做软件开发)

6、电子信息专业:这个专业的同学,就像是电子世界的“魔法师”,对电路、信号什么的都不在话下,敲代码也是他们的必备技能哦!通信专业:通信专业的同学们,他们的代码就像是信息的“桥梁”,让数据在网络的海洋中自由穿梭。

游戏开发需要学些什么

1、游戏开发需要学习多种程序语言,同时会用到不同类型的软件:程序语言 ①C++:这是游戏开发中使用频率较高的语言之一。它能提供高性能的代码执行以及底层控制能力,并且有众多游戏引擎提供支持,像Unreal Engine就广泛使用C++。如果想开发大型、复杂的游戏项目,学习C++是很有必要的。

2、学习游戏开发需要掌握以下知识: 游戏编辑软件 3d**AX:被许多游戏开发公司的美工广泛使用,能够独立完成游戏中的所有美术资源制作。 MAYA:与3d**AX功能兼容,但在制作动作方面略有不足。 Deeppaint3D:可以打开3维模型文件,并在上面绘制贴图。 Photoshop与Panter:配合3d**AX或MAYA绘制模型所需的贴图。

3、游戏开发需要学习的内容主要包括以下几个方面: 编程语言基础 C#语言基础:学习C#的基本语法,如数据类型、语句、运算符、控制语句等。C#是游戏开发中常用的编程语言,特别是对于使用Unity引擎的开发者。 Unity引擎学习 Unity基础:掌握Unity引擎的基本操作,包括创建项目、场景管理、资源导入等。

4、游戏开发工程师需要学习的内容主要包括以下几点: 编程语言基础 VC、DELPHI和JAVA:VC因其广泛的应用而受到青睐,适合开发大型游戏;DELPHI功能强大,曾被用于制作网游;JAVA则擅长于手机游戏的开发。

5、做游戏开发需要学习以下核心技术:计算机科学与编程基础:掌握至少一种主流编程语言,如C++、C#或Python,熟悉语法、面向对象编程及内存管理;理解算法与数据结构,如路径查找、排序、图论等,用于优化游戏性能;具备线性代数、几何学、物理学等数学基础,支撑图形渲染与物理仿真。

学软件开发需要有什么基础?

学习软件开发要有以下基础:基础编程语言 编程语言是学软件开发的钥匙,初学者好根据自身的喜好或者职业规划选择语言。目前主流的编程语言包括Java、PHP、.net、C#语言等,新手建议从C语言开始,是基础也实用的语言,之后也可以慢慢扩展。其实很多编程语言之间有所互通,比如数据类型、变量、常量等。

学习软件开发需要以下基础知识和技能: 编程基础:学习一种编程语言,如Python、Java、C++等,并了解基本的编程语法、数据结构和算法。 网络基础:了解计算机网络的基本原理,如IP地址、端口、HTTP协议等。 操作系统基础:掌握操作系统的基本概念和原理,如进程管理、内存管理、文件系统等。

学软件开发要会:编程语言:如Python、Java、C++等。编程基础:掌握变量、数据类型、条件语句、循环结构、函数、面向对象编程等。开发工具:如IDE或文本编辑器。数据结构和算法。版本控制工具:如Git。软件开发流程:如需求分析、设计、编码、测试和部署等。

软件开发程序猿学什么(学做软件开发)

程序员是干嘛的

银行程序员主要负责以下几个方面的工作:设计、开发、测试与维护银行系统:银行程序员设计和开发银行的核心系统、交易系统以及信息安全系统,确保这些系统能够高效、稳定地运行。他们还负责对这些系统进行测试,以确保其质量和性能符合银行的要求。维护工作包括修复系统漏洞、更新系统功能和优化系统性能等。

程序员是通过编写代码构建和维护软件系统,解决实际问题以满足用户需求的专业人员,其工作涉及多方面技能与复杂挑战,需持续学习精进。核心工作内容程序员的核心任务是构建和维护软件系统,涵盖从需求分析到最终部署的全流程。

代码开发与调试核心编码任务:根据需求编写代码,实现功能模块。例如,开发一个用户登录系统,需处理前端交互、后端逻辑、数据库存储等环节。调试与修复Bug:代码运行中可能出现逻辑错误、性能问题或兼容性故障。程序员需通过日志分析、调试工具定位问题,例如修复一个导致页面崩溃的空指针异常。

银行程序员在现代银行业中的角色日益重要,他们主要负责设计、开发、测试与维护银行的核心系统、交易系统和信息安全系统。随着银行业务的日益复杂化,信息和数据量急剧增加,确保数据处理的高效性和安全性成为关键任务。因此,银行程序员需要具备扎实的编程技能和深厚的计算机技术知识。

程序员的工作内容如下:负责软件项目的详细设计、编码和内部测试的组织实施,对小型软件项目兼任系统分析工作,完成分配项目的实施和技术支持工作。协助项目经理和相关人员同客户进行沟通,保持良好的客户关系。参与需求调研、项目可行性分析、技术可行性分析和需求分析。

java开发都需要学什么

1、主要的学习内容是:HTML、CSS、JavaScript、JQuery 、Bootstrap。 第四阶段 数据库相关 页面已经能做了,那么页面渲染的数据是从哪儿来 的?数据库! 这里主要学习MySql,Oracie看实际开发中需要再进 行学习。

2、JavaSE:基本语法:这是学习Java的基石,包括变量、数据类型、运算符等。面向对象:理解类、对象、继承、封装、多态等概念。常用API:掌握Java标准库中的常用类和方法。线程与并发:学习多线程编程,以及并发控制的相关知识。网络编程:了解网络通信的基本原理,以及Java中的网络编程接口。

3、Java软件开发需要学习的内容涵盖多个方面,具体如下:核心语言基础Java语法:这是Java开发的基础,包括数据类型(如整型、浮点型、字符型等)、变量(用于存储数据的容器)、运算符(用于进行各种运算,如算术运算、逻辑运算等)以及控制流结构(如条件语句if-else、循环语句for、while等)。

4、学习JAVA不能丢掉的8个项目 极致精简的Java Bootique是一项用于构建无容器可运行Java应用的极简技术。该项目允许大家创建REST服务、Web应用、任务、数据库迁移等等,且一切都立足于模块实现。 该项目的目标在于将应用从Java容器中解放出来,允许开发者重新回归main()方法。

内容声明:本文中引用的各种信息及资料(包括但不限于文字、数据、图表及超链接等)均来源于该信息及资料的相关主体(包括但不限于公司、媒体、协会等机构》的官方网站或公开发表的信息,内容仅供参考使用!本站为非盈利性质站点,本着免费分享原则,发布内容不收取任何费用也不接任何广告! 【若侵害到您的利益,请联系我们删除处理。投诉邮箱:121998431@qq.com